Output 58675d735551e9c543bc789a0a20c905ddbde5d768dbecebbe3c6e658d4f2a3e:1

value
17636647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ba8cf85c4740a1e69f54c19a2cbed4d43355d9c OP_EQUAL
address
MPYp1QFfU54neEKWP1bC38byEqf6hQUU1G
transaction
58675d735551e9c543bc789a0a20c905ddbde5d768dbecebbe3c6e658d4f2a3e
spent
true